The Problems of Agricultural Development and Their Solutions
Inadequate Land or Land Tenure System
This problem is discussed under the following points:
- Increase in Population increases alternative use of land for agriculture which will reduce the size of farm land
- The type of Land Tenure system which encourages family ownership of land does not allow farmers to acquire large areas of land for commercial agriculture
- It leads to land fragmentation which does not support mechanization.
- Deforestation and desert encroachment contribute lack of land.
- Soil erosion and marshy or swamping areas also contributes to lack of farm land.
